Study Summary
Changes in adipose tissue biology are now recognized as a key factor underlying the increased risk of metabolic and cardiovascular disease with obesity. Clinical interest in adipocyte-derived extracellular vesicles (Ad-EVs) has intensified due to their potential as circulating biomarkers of adipose tissue health and systemic messengers, regulators and mediators of cardiometabolic health and disease with obesity. The investigators hypothesize that elevated Ad-EVs in adults with obesity will be negatively associated with endothelium-dependent vasodilation. Furthermore, the investigators hypothesize that in adults with obesity, intentional weight loss-induced reduction in circulating Ad-EVs is associated with greater endothelium-dependent vasodilation.
Primary Outcome
Circulating Ad-EVs will be determined from a peripheral blood sample in normal weight and obese adults. Ad-EVs will be determined using flow cytometry. The samples will be incubated with perilipin A. Ad-EVs will be defined as perilipin A positive cells ranging in size 0.2-0.8 um.
